pooja Hegde’s recent career graph has been a rollercoaster, with a string of underwhelming films casting a shadow over her once soaring momentum. Her last major appearance was in Retro alongside Suriya, where she took a bold step by opting for a de-glam, performance-heavy role. Unfortunately, the film didn’t strike a chord with audiences, and her subdued portrayal received mixed reactions, with many questioning her career choices. For an actress once hailed for her mass appeal and glamorous presence, the lukewarm response to Retro added to a growing narrative that she was struggling to find her footing again.

But in a classic twist of fate, pooja hegde turned the tide dramatically with just one song — monica from the Rajinikanth starrer Coolie. The item number, which could have been just another commercial filler, became a cultural moment thanks to her electric screen presence, graceful moves, and renewed confidence. The song went viral across platforms, trended at #1 on YouTube, and brought her back into the limelight in the most unexpected way. Audiences couldn’t take their eyes off her, and suddenly, the same critics who doubted her comeback began praising her screen magnetism.

Acknowledging her impact, the makers of Coolie went a step further by crowning her the “Chartbuster Queen” in the official lyrical video — a title that resonated deeply with fans.
